Transaction 25402310d8ddc3cf54e3e1ac4c403101d6f34e77b7fcf5d19a4e967d2f704a4c

28 Input
2 Outputs
  • 25402310d8ddc3cf54e3e1ac4c403101d6f34e77b7fcf5d19a4e967d2f704a4c:0
  • value  702615
    address  38qvcpabBcHa3VfFHrXxjQBY7Z7y15XYAv
  • 25402310d8ddc3cf54e3e1ac4c403101d6f34e77b7fcf5d19a4e967d2f704a4c:1
  • value  424737737
    address  3GUBFmEwZqPLbCLY89Ffx6aK5ND6iJK9GC